Job Summary

The Security Application Support (Zscaler Support Administrator) role ensures the secure implementation, configuration, and ongoing operational health of the MBTA's Secure Access Service Edge (SASE) environment and integrated security platforms. This position provides technical expertise across cloud security services, user access technologies, and threat prevention capabilities to protect MBTA systems, data, and users. The role supports both project-based initiatives and day-to-day operations, partnering closely with security engineering, infrastructure, and application teams to maintain resilient, compliant, and Zero Trust aligned security controls.

The scope of this role includes initial configuration, deployment, administration, monitoring, and continuous improvement of SASE components; integration with Microsoft cloud and endpoint protection technologies; troubleshooting of user and system issues; policy development and tuning; documentation of operational standards; and participation in threat intelligence and remediation activities. The position also contributes to security architecture enhancements, assists with cloud migration efforts, and advises on emerging security acquisitions to ensure alignment with MBTA Information Security policies, industry best practices, and regulatory requirements.

Duties & Responsibilities
  • Perform initial configuration and setup of the SASE cloud (Internet Access, Private Access, digital experience, SAML, add-ons, etc.).
  • Assist with various implementation projects as they relate to Azure, Intune, Office 365, and application cloud migrations.
  • Investigate and apply SASE best practices.
  • Provide comprehensive administration and support of the Zscaler platform (ZIA, ZPA), including daily operational tasks, policy updates, SSL inspection management, certificate workflows, log analysis, troubleshooting, and coordination with Zscaler TAC.
  • Perform day-to-day administration of the SASE.
  • Document SASE standard operating procedures and protocols.
  • Create SASE dashboards and reports to monitor and ensure SASE health.
  • Coordinate and leverage threat intelligence to prevent and remediate vulnerabilities and threats.
  • Receive and fulfill technical work assignments – Service Now and data calls.
  • Fulfill policy requests to fine tune operations of the SASE Standards that align with Information Security Policies.
  • Monitor, troubleshoot and resolve user experience issues and provide remediation recommendations.
  • Assist other system and security engineers in optimizing policies and user configuration.
  • Document issues and escalate to next tier or vendor support, as necessary.
  • Monitor systems consoles and remediate alerts.
  • Perform policy administration for web proxies, URL filtering, secure web gateway, CASB, and data loss prevention.
  • Support integration with Microsoft products like Azure Active Directory and Microsoft Conditional Access Policies.
  • Support integration with EDR products like Crowd Strike.
  • Identify and recommend Security Architecture Improvements or solutions for review by leadership and continue to be a champion of Zero Trust maturity at the MBTA.
  • Serve as an advisor on new security acquisitions.
  • Perform all other duties and projects that may be assigned.
